Nail Polish Dryers Damage Dna . Radiation from nail dryers may damage dna and cause permanent mutations in human cells, a study has found. The experiment's findings suggest uv light from nail lamps can damage the dna of human and mice cells in similar ways. Dermatologists weigh in on the risks and whether they avoid gel manicures.
